Job summary

Jobtailor in New Jersey seeks an experienced Project Manager to drive governance and regulatory initiatives, including data security and records management. You will lead planning, milestones, and risk management for strategic programs and coordinate across GRACS and enterprise functions.

The role requires exceptional communication, stakeholder management, and the ability to translate complex requirements into actionable plans.

Responsibilities

  • Lead planning, coordination, and execution of assigned strategic initiatives
  • Develop and manage project plans, governance structures, implementation activities, milestones, risks, and deliverables
  • Establish and lead the GRACS records management and document retention program, including standards, governance, processes, tools, and controls
  • Support execution of the GRACS Data Security Program, including monitoring, reporting, documentation, and governance
  • Focus on sensitive data transfers and related compliance requirements
  • Collaborate with business process owners to develop, maintain, and assess privacy impact assessments and compliance documentation
  • Coordinate annual privacy assessments and remediation activities across GRACS
  • Ensure third-party due diligence processes are completed, documented, monitored, and renewed for global and U.S.-based vendors and service providers
  • Drive continuous improvement of governance, compliance, and operational processes
  • Provide leadership communications, metrics, and status reporting
  • Partner with stakeholders across GRACS and enterprise functions including Information Technology, Finance, Procurement, Legal, Privacy, and Corporate Security
